Just How Roof Covering Air Flow Functions



Reliable roof covering air flow depends on the natural activity of air to develop a balance between consumption and exhaust. When you mount vents, you're basically enabling fresh air to enter your attic while making it possible for warm, stagnant air to get away. This process assists control temperature and wetness levels, protecting against issues like mold and mildew development and roofing damages.

Consumption vents, commonly discovered at the eaves, draw in cool air from outdoors. At the same time, exhaust vents, located near the ridge of the roofing system, let hot air surge and departure. The difference in temperature level produces an all-natural air flow, known as the pile impact. As warm air surges, it develops a vacuum cleaner that draws in cooler air from the lower vents.



To optimize this system, you require to make certain that the intake and exhaust vents are properly sized and placed. If the intake is restricted, you will not accomplish the preferred air flow.

Likewise, inadequate exhaust can trap warm and wetness, leading to prospective damages.

Key Installment Considerations



When installing roofing system ventilation, a number of essential factors to consider can make or break your system's effectiveness. Initially, you need to analyze your roofing system's design. The pitch, form, and products all influence air movement and ventilation choice. Ensure to choose vents that match your roofing system type and neighborhood environment problems.

Next, take into consideration the positioning of your vents. Ideally, you'll desire a balanced system with intake and exhaust vents positioned for optimum airflow. Area consumption vents low on the roofing system and exhaust vents near the height to motivate an all-natural flow of air. This configuration helps stop wetness accumulation and advertises energy effectiveness.

Do not forget insulation. Correct insulation in your attic stops warm from getting away and keeps your home comfy. Guarantee that insulation doesn't obstruct your vents, as this can hinder airflow.
